What I used- in order-

EYES-
1. Primed my eye lids with Urban Decay primer
2. MAC Painterly paint pot - from lash line to brow
3. MAC e/s in Rice Paper
4. MAC paint pot in Rubenesque- on lid and small amount on brow bone
5. MAC e/s in Goldmine on whole lid
6. MAC e/s in All That Glitters on the brow bone
7. MAC e/s in Twinks on the outer v of your lid
8.Vanilla eye shadow as your highlight (right below the brow)
9. Finish the look by adding MAC fluidline in blacktrack to upper lash line and then MAC liner in Smolder to inside of upper and lower lashline and then curl your lashes and use MAC mascara in Dazzle lash...

FACE-
1. Smashbox Photo finish - primer
2. MAC Studio Sculpt concealer in nw25 for under eyes, sides of nostrals for me (my smile lines)
3. Makeup Forever Matte Velvet foundation #35 mixed with NARS luminizer (to help with a glow and less matte look)
4. MAC Bronzing powder in Golden
5. MAC blush in Blunt for contour definition below cheek bones
6.NARS blush in Orgasm on balls of cheeks


LIPS-
MAC cremestick liner in Beurre
MAC lipstick in Creme D'nude
MAC lipglass in Dreamy
